    Why don't you call the vowel sound in HUT the schaw ?

    • @mrmememe777
      @mrmememe777  Před 2 lety +1

      The schwa is only in unstressed syllables. One syllable words like "hut" have one stressed syllable called a short "u" sound. Thanks for watching.
